The phase of nuclear regeneration of K(S) mesons in a K(L) beam is rel
ated to the momentum dependence of the regeneration amplitude (f(0) -
fBAR(0))/k, via a dispersion relation. Using experimental data on the
momentum dependence of the modulus of the amplitude, values for the re
generation phase are derived for the regenerator materials copper, lea
d, carbon and carborundum (B4C). The precision of these phases is abou
t +/-3-degrees in the momentum region from 40 to 150 GeV/c. This uncer
tainty limits the precision of measurements on the CP-violation phase
phi+- in regenerator experiments.
